Internal linking is a crucial aspect of managing large blogs. It helps improve navigation, enhances SEO, and distributes page authority across your website. A well-planned internal linking strategy ensures that readers and search engines can easily find relevant content, increasing engagement and ranking potential.
Why Internal Linking Matters
Internal links connect one page of your website to another, creating a web of related content. This not only guides visitors to additional resources but also helps search engines understand the structure of your site. Effective internal linking can:
- Improve user experience by making navigation intuitive
- Increase the time visitors spend on your site
- Distribute link equity across important pages
- Enhance your SEO rankings for targeted keywords
Strategies for Effective Internal Linking
Implementing a successful internal linking strategy involves planning and consistency. Here are some key strategies:
1. Use Descriptive Anchor Text
Choose anchor text that clearly describes the linked page. Avoid generic phrases like “click here.” Instead, use keywords relevant to the destination page to boost SEO.
2. Link to Related Content
Identify related articles, categories, or pages and link to them naturally within your content. This encourages readers to explore more of your site.
3. Create a Hierarchical Structure
Organize your content into categories and subcategories. Link from broader pages to more specific ones, creating a clear hierarchy that search engines can understand.
Tools and Plugins to Aid Internal Linking
Several tools can help automate and optimize internal linking:
- Yoast SEO: Provides internal linking suggestions
- Link Whisper: Automates internal link creation
- SEOPress: Offers internal linking recommendations
Best Practices and Tips
To maximize the benefits of your internal linking strategy, keep these best practices in mind:
- Regularly audit your links to fix broken or outdated ones
- Avoid overlinking, which can appear spammy
- Prioritize linking to high-value pages
- Use a natural, user-friendly tone in your anchor text
By implementing a thoughtful internal linking strategy, large blogs can improve their SEO performance, enhance user experience, and ensure that valuable content is easily discoverable. Consistency and regular updates are key to maintaining an effective internal link structure over time.
